Lane's Arabic-English Lexicon

إِسْتَنْفَرَهُمْ

Root: نفر

Form: 10

Full Definition

إِسْتَنْفَرَهُمْX He incited, and summoned or invited them to go forth, لِجِهَادِ العَدُوِّ to war against the enemy: or imposed upon them the task of going forth to war, light and heavy: [see Kur, ix. 41:] or he demanded, sought, or desired, of them aid.
